2000 Chevy cavalier problems?

Hi i have a 2000 Chevy cavalier. I have several problems with this car...its a cavalier. Well its my only car that i can afford epically with the gas being so high. One of my major concerns is there is a loud knocking noise when i step on the gas accompanied with major vibration. I have changed the motor mount the toque mount and the transmission mount still does the same thing. There is also oil in my blow by but none i can see in my air filter what does that mean, and what do i need to do to fix it? I have already replaced the motor in this car because my timing belt broke and the person i sent it too said it would be cheaper this way. I have no idea how many miles are on the motor just the vehicle itself. I also would like to know what are some cheep performance parts i could just slap on to make this car tolerant it is a 2000 Chevy cavalier...of course...2 door coupe with just a standard 2.2L. If you could also help me out with a website that sells cheep performance parts as well that would be awesome. Thanks for all your time.2000 Chevy cavalier problems?

First of all, I believe that your motor doesn't have a timing belt, it has a timing chain. Unlike a belt, they become badly stretched and won't break.



Secondly, the blow by could mean as little as a faulty PCV valve or as major as bad piston rings. If your motor is hitting the firewall, that is due to a bad installation and should be checked for safety reasons as well as the knocking nuisance.
